Wyoming Statutes

§ 34.1-9-805 — Effectiveness of action taken before July 1, 2013

Wyoming·Title 34.1 Uniform Commercial Code·Art. 9 SECURED TRANSACTIONS
(a)The filing of a financing statement before July 1, 2013, is effective to perfect a security interest to the extent the filing would satisfy the applicable requirements for perfection under this title, as amended by the 2013 amendments.
(b)The 2013 amendments do not render ineffective an effective financing statement that, before July 1, 2013, is filed and satisfies the applicable requirements for perfection under the law of the jurisdiction governing perfection as provided in this title, as it existed before the 2013 amendments.
